Tetracera sarmentosa (L.) Vahl [ Delima sarmentosa L.]
      
no HD illustration available (m3)
6 1005393 Tetracera sarmentosa (L.) Vahl [125 323920 Delima sarmentosa L.] Dilleniaceae
W. Curtis, Bot. Mag., vol. 58 [ser. 2, vol. 5]: t. 3058 (1831) [W.J. Hooker]